About the Role:
Reporting to the National Business Manager, you will be responsible for owning sales data preparation, analysis & interpretation, as well as managing the daily administration of retailers within the corporate accounts.  The role requires high levels of analytical ability, excellent computer (Excel) skills, and the ability to collaborate with all departments, in particular Marketing, Customer Service & Merchandising.

 

You Will Be Responsible For:

  • Preparation of sales data for weekly sales meetings and customer strategies
  • Interpreting sales data, & drawing insights to assist with managing accounts
  • Management of retailer requirements, e.g. new line submission process, promotions, product image files, order lifecycle, range forms & price files etc.
  • Managing the administration of the national merchandising program including briefing documents, tester allocations, POS allocation management, store listing maintenance & weekly KPI report
  • Providing Account Management support to the National Business Manager & the National Account Manager across high profile key accounts
